keyboardjunkie Posted May 1, 2021 #190 Share Posted May 1, 2021 33 minutes ago, leo72976 said: Now that the US is not going to allow Indian nationals into the US starting in a few days, I wonder how this will affect crewing some ships since there is a large number of Indians working onboard. Just another monkey wrench thrown into the mix..... Yes, BUT, crew have a very different VISA for the USA. They obatin a Crewmember Visa ( see https://travel.state.gov/content/travel/en/us-visas/other-visa-categories/crewmember-visa.html ). This is very different from other types of visas (i.e. an I-9). Where we can see the 'monkey wrench' you mention is in that crew members must have a C-1 transit visa to enter the USA to meet a ship. Hence, we believe that what will occur is that crew members will join ships outside the USA and then transit into the USA while completing their guaranteeing on the ship. Just our un-expert analysis...... 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
